18
Q

What is the frequency range for the extremely high frequency (EHF) band?

A

30 GHz-300GHz

19
Q

What is the frequency range for the super high frequency (SHF) band?

A

3GHz-30GHz

20
Q

What is the frequency range for the ultra high frequency (UHF) band?

A

300MHz-3GHz

21
Q

What is the frequency range for the very high frequency (VHF) band?

A

30MHz-300MHz

22
Q

What is the frequency range for the high frequency (HF) band?

A

3MHz-30MHz

23
Q

What is the frequency range for the medium frequency (MF) band?

A

300KHz-3MHz

24
Q

What is the frequency range for the low frequency (LF) band?

A

30 KHz-300KHz

25
Q

What is the frequency range for the very low frequency (VLF) band?

A

3KHz-30KHz

26
Q

What is the frequency range for the extremely low frequency (ELF) band?

A

Up to 300Hz
